As far as I can see you don't yet introduce any checks. It makes patchset somewhat pointless. I'm not entirely sure how such checks would look like. The single page table tree would have at least two pt_mm: the owner and init_mm. Hugetlb shared page tables would make a mess here. Hm? -- Kirill A. Shutemov
